Birth and Death Records

Birth and death records in Bourbon, Indiana, are maintained by the Marshall County Health Department. To obtain a copy of a birth or death certificate, you can visit the Health Department in person or submit a request by mail. The contact information for the Marshall County Health Department is as follows:

Marshall County Health Department
112 W. Jefferson St., Room 101
Plymouth, IN 46563
Phone: (574) 935-8565
Website: https://www.co.marshall.in.us/department/index.php?structureid=17

Marriage and Divorce Records

Marriage and divorce records for Bourbon, Indiana, can be obtained through the Marshall County Clerk's Office. To request a copy of a marriage or divorce record, you can visit the Clerk's Office in person or submit a request by mail. The contact information for the Marshall County Clerk's Office is as follows:

Marshall County Clerk's Office
211 W. Madison St.
Plymouth, IN 46563
Phone: (574) 935-8713
Website: https://www.co.marshall.in.us/department/index.php?structureid=16

Property Records

Property records for Bourbon, Indiana, can be accessed through the Marshall County Assessor's Office. The Assessor's Office maintains records on property ownership, assessments, and taxes. To access property records, you can visit the Assessor's Office in person or use their online property search tool. The contact information for the Marshall County Assessor's Office is as follows:

Marshall County Assessor's Office
112 W. Jefferson St., Room 201
Plymouth, IN 46563
Phone: (574) 935-8531
Website: https://www.co.marshall.in.us/department/index.php?structureid=18
Online Property Search: https://www.co.marshall.in.us/egov/apps/services/index.egov?view=detail;id=2

Historical Documents and Photographs

Historical documents and photographs related to Bourbon, Indiana, can be found at the Bourbon Public Library. The library maintains a local history collection that includes books, newspapers, photographs, and other materials related to the town's history. To access these materials, you can visit the library in person or contact them by phone or email. The contact information for the Bourbon Public Library is as follows:

Bourbon Public Library
307 N. Main St.
Bourbon, IN 46504
Phone: (574) 342-5655
Email: bourbonlibrary@hotmail.com
Website: https://www.bourbon.lib.in.us/
